By Celestine Okafor (Editor-in-Chief)

The Economic and Financial Crimes Commission and the National Open University of Nigeria NOUN, on Wednesday, October 13, 2021, formalized their collaboration with the signing of a Memorandum of Understanding, MoU, which will see the Commission working closely with the University’s Centre of Excellence on Technology Enhanced Learning, ACETEL, in cybersecurity training, among others.

By Cosmas Enahoro (Edo State Correspondent)

The Benin Zonal Command of the Economic and Financial Crimes Commission (EFCC), has arraigned the duo of Ukhuriegbe Glory Irekpitan and Onyekwa Joshua Chinedum before Justice S. M. Shuaibu of the Federal High Court sitting in Benin, Edo State on two-count charge each of impersonation.

By Celestine Okafor (Editor-in-Chief)

The Economic and Financial Crimes Commission EFCC today, Tuesday, October 12, 2021, arraigned a former Vice-Chancellor of Federal University Gusau, Professor Magaji Garba before Justice Maryam Hassan Aliyu of the Federal Capital Territory High Court, Jabi Abuja on a five-count charge bordering on obtaining money by false pretense and forgery,

By Sharon Ngozi Nwabiani (Senior Correspondent, in Lagos)

The existing collaboration between the Economic and Financial Crimes Commission, EFCC, and the Security and Exchange Commission, SEC, received a boost with a capacity-building training for select officers of the Commission in the Lagos Zonal Command.

By Sharon Ngozi Nwabiani (Senior Correspondent, in Lagos)

The trial of Ugwu Pascal and Ibrahim Sadiq, who impersonated operatives of the Economic and Financial Crimes Commission, EFCC, commenced on Tuesday, October 12, 2021, following their arraignment before Justice O.O. Abike-Fadipe of the Special Offences Court sitting in Ikeja, Lagos.
